Obama Administration "is now going to have to dig himself out of" DOMA Brief Mess

Former Democratic National Committee chairman and Vermont governor Howard Dean appeared on The Rachel Maddow Show on Monday night to discuss the recent U.S. Department of Justice brief that defends the Defense of Marriage Act by making comparisons to pedophilia and incest. Dean, who called the brief a “big mistake,” focused his critique on its language, while maintaining that President Obama could not have been aware of it. He also suggested that the uproar caused by the brief will necessitate some kind of make good to the LGBT community, most likely in the way of earlier action to repeal the “don’t ask, don’t tell” policy. “The language in this brief is really offensive and it really is a terrible mistake,” said Dean. “I doubt very much the president knew this was coming. I don’t think for a minute this represents the president’s position. But he is now going to have to dig himself out of this, because people are really upset about this, not just in the gay and lesbian community, but in the community of people who are interested in equal rights,” he said.
